欧美bbbwbbbw肥妇,免费乱码人妻系列日韩,一级黄片

Oracle密碼文件的使用和維護第3/3頁

 更新時間:2007年03月06日 00:00:00   作者:  
  四、使用密碼文件登錄:

  有了密碼文件后,用戶就可以使用密碼文件以SYSOPER/SYSDBA權限登錄Oracle數(shù)據(jù)庫實例了,注意初始化參數(shù)REMOTE_LOGIN_PASSWORDFILE應設置為EXCLUSIVE或SHARED。任何用戶以SYSOPER/SYSDBA的權限登錄后,將位于SYS用戶的Schema之下,以下為兩個登錄的例子:

  1. 以管理員身份登錄: 

  假設用戶scott已被授予SYSDBA權限,則他可以使用以下命令登錄: 

  CONNECT scott/tiger AS SYSDBA 

  2. 以INTERNAL身份登錄: 

  CONNECT INTERNAL/INTERNAL_PASSWORD 

  五、密碼文件的維護:

  1. 查看密碼文件中的成員:

  可以通過查詢視圖V$PWFILE_USERS來獲取擁有SYSOPER/SYSDBA系統(tǒng)權限的用戶的信息,表中SYSOPER/SYSDBA列的取值TRUE/FALSE表示此用戶是否擁有相應的權限。這些用戶也就是相應地存在于密碼文件中的成員。 

  2. 擴展密碼文件的用戶數(shù)量: 

  當向密碼文件添加的帳號數(shù)目超過創(chuàng)建密碼文件時所定的限制(即ORAPWD.EXE工具的MAX_USERS參數(shù))時,為擴展密碼文件的用戶數(shù)限制,需重建密碼文件,具體步驟如下: 

  a) 查詢視圖V$PWFILE_USERS,記錄下?lián)碛蠸YSOPER/SYSDBA系統(tǒng)權限的用戶信息; 

  b) 關閉數(shù)據(jù)庫; 

  c) 刪除密碼文件; 

  d) 用ORAPWD.EXE新建一密碼文件; 

  e) 將步驟a中獲取的用戶添加到密碼文件中。 

  3. 修改密碼文件的狀態(tài): 

  密碼文件的狀態(tài)信息存放于此文件中,當它被創(chuàng)建時,它的缺省狀態(tài)為SHARED??梢酝ㄟ^改變初始化參數(shù)REMOTE_LOGIN_PASSWORDFILE的設置改變密碼文件的狀態(tài)。當啟動數(shù)據(jù)庫事例時,Oracle系統(tǒng)從初始化參數(shù)文件中讀取REMOTE_LOGIN_PASSWORDFILE參數(shù)的設置;當加載數(shù)據(jù)庫時,系統(tǒng)將此參數(shù)與口令文件的狀態(tài)進行比較,如果不同,則更新密碼文件的狀態(tài)。若計劃允許從多臺客戶機上啟動數(shù)據(jù)庫實例,由于各客戶機上必須有初始化參數(shù)文件,所以應確保各客戶機上的初始化參數(shù)文件的一致性,以避免意外地改變了密碼文件的狀態(tài),造成數(shù)據(jù)庫登陸的失敗。 

[1] [2] 下一頁

正在看的ORACLE教程是:Oracle密碼文件的使用和維護?! ?. 修改密碼文件的存儲位置: 

  密碼文件的存放位置可以根據(jù)需要進行移動,但作此修改后,應相應修改系統(tǒng)注冊庫有關指向密碼文件存放位置的參數(shù)或環(huán)境變量的設置。 

  5. 刪除密碼文件: 

  在刪除密碼文件前,應確保當前運行的各數(shù)據(jù)庫實例的初始化參數(shù)REMOTE_LOGIN_PASSWORDFILE皆設置為NONE。在刪除密碼文件后,若想要以管理員身份連入數(shù)據(jù)庫的話,則必須使用操作系統(tǒng)驗證的方法進行登錄。


上一頁  [1] [2] 

相關文章

最新評論